What are some other conditions that your optometrist can pick up early?
As part of a regular eye health check (if you are over 40 years). A number of general health disorders (e.g. diabetes, hypertension) can show as changes in the back of the eye. Age-related eye changes (e.g. cataracts, macular degeneration) can be detected earlier with regular eye health checks. Raised pressure in the eye (glaucoma) can normally only be detected by regular eye health check.
